Strategic Planning for Travel and Stay
Once the world cup 2026 host cities are confirmed, the next challenge is aligning your travel itinerary with the match schedule. Proximity to airports, availability of public transport, and the concentration of fan zones are all factors that can significantly enhance the experience. Booking accommodations well in advance is strongly advised, as the influx of supporters will put pressure on hotels in metropolitan areas near the stadiums.
Identifying Official Sales Channels
To avoid scams and ensure a legitimate purchase, fans must rely on official FIFA platforms for the world cup 2026 tickets. Third-party resellers may offer inflated prices or counterfeit entries, leading to disappointment and financial loss. Staying vigilant and monitoring the official announcements regarding the sales calendar will help supporters secure their seats through reliable and transparent channels.
Budgeting for the Ultimate Fan Experience
Attending the world cup 2026 is a significant investment, requiring careful financial planning beyond just the world cup 2026 tickets. Expenses such as international flights, local transportation, and meals in high-demand cities can add up quickly. Creating a detailed budget that accounts for these variables ensures that the focus remains on the spectacle of the game rather than financial stress upon arrival.
